We’re working with a leading live events and production specialist looking for an experienced Technical Project Manager to deliver large-scale corporate and broadcast events across London and beyond.

This is a senior, client-facing role responsible for the end-to-end technical delivery of live events — from concept and design through to on-site execution and post-event close.

The role:

  • Own and manage technical event delivery across multiple complex live events
  • Translate client requirements into clear technical, production, and labour plans
  • Lead on-site technical teams, vendors, and venue partners during load-in, show, and load-out
  • Ensure projects are delivered on time, on budget, and to a world-class standard
  • Act as the main client contact on-site, managing expectations and last-minute changes
  • Oversee H&S compliance (RAMS), technical standards, and operational best practice
  • Manage budgets, cost control, and post-event reconciliation

What we’re looking for:

  • 4+ years’ experience in corporate events, live production.
  • Strong technical background (audio, video, lighting, staging, or integrated AV)
  • Proven experience managing complex live events end to end
  • Confident leading teams and communicating with senior clients
  • Comfortable working in fast-paced, high-pressure live environments
  • Budget management and operational logistics experience
  • Willingness to travel and work flexible hours as required by events
